Strategic Construction & Design Leader - Healthcare
As a Strategic Construction & Design Leader, you will advise and partner with health systems executives and design/construction teams to integrate Philips technologies into facility design and capital planning, ensuring future-ready healthcare environments aligned with clinical workflows, sustainability goals, and technology requirements to strengthen long-term partnerships. **Your role:** + Advise C-suite and capital planning teams on facility strategies and technology roadmaps, translating clinical, operational, and financial goals into integrated solutions. Lead visioning sessions and executive briefings to position Philips as a long-term strategic partner. + Build strong relationships with health system leaders and industry partners while serving as the primary strategic contact to align Philips’ internal teams with external stakeholders. Represent Philips in planning groups and forums to reinforce its position as a trusted thought leader. + Provide early input on space planning, equipment layout, and workflow optimization to influence Request for Proposals (RFPs) and funding decisions, supported by feasibility and risk analyses that guide budgeting and reduce late-stage changes. Collaborate with account and design teams to position Philips solutions and define specifications for strategic capital projects. + Maintain executive engagement during project execution by advising on design changes, construction impacts, and technology integration. Drive future refresh, expansion, and sustainability plans to keep Philips embedded in long-term capital strategies. + Serve as a strategic thought partner to collaborate across the Philips enterprise, guiding Integrated Delivery Network (IDN) construction strategy and pre/post deal success. Will initially serve as a leader of influence, with a future roadmap to lead a team of direct reports. **You're the right fit if:** + You’ve acquired 5+ years of experience in healthcare facility strategy, project management, and/or design advisory within a healthcare or medical technology setting. + Your skills include a strong understanding of healthcare construction standards, project management, regulatory codes, business development acumen, and clinical workflow design. + You have bachelor’s degree in architecture, engineering, healthcare administration, or another related field of study. Master’s degree is preferred. + You have a proven ability to influence senior executives and diverse stakeholder groups without direct authority. + You must be able to successfully perform the following minimum Physical, Cognitive and Environmental job requirements with or without accommodation for this Sales position. + You must be able to: + Travel for business; operate a company motor vehicle/drive (maintain licensure and comply with fleet policy). Approximately 70% travel to customer locations across the United States is required. + Work in an office/home office and/or remote setting. + Work in a hospital/healthcare environment (must adhere to hospital/healthcare environment requirements and comply with vendor credentialing). **How we work together** We believe that we are better together than apart.
